Employees Of Russia's Israeli Embassy Charged With Fraud - Investigators

MOSCOW (Pakistan Point News / Sputnik - 06th June, 2019) Three staffers at the Russian Embassy in Israel have been charged with defrauding the mission of millions of rubles between 2012 and 2014, the Federal Investigative Committee said Thursday.

"Depending on their role, each suspect � Anna Sidorova, Natalia Zhuravlyova and Irina Los � has been charged with crimes ... (fraud and acting as an accessory to fraud)," the committee said in a statement.

Investigators believe that Zhuravlyova abused her position as a chief accountant to steal 49 million rubles ($751,800 at the current exchange rate) from the embassy's accounts with the help of Sidorova and Los.

"The criminals fulfilled their criminal intent by misleading the embassy's authority and forging receipts for the lease, taxes and other local fees," the investigators said.

They used illicit gains to buy property in Moscow and the Moscow Region, which has since been seized so that it can be resold to repay the embassy's losses. The attorney general's office will now decide how to proceed with the case.
